NOTE
The “I
panel
” value varies depending on the type of solar panel installed. Refer to
the vendors specifications for the solar panel being used.
For example, if I
array
equals 0.54 amps, and I
panel
equals 0.29 amps for a 5-watt panel, then the number
of panels required equals 1.86, which would be rounded up to 2 (panels connected in parallel).
Alternatively, the next larger solar panel can be used, which in this case would be a 10-watt panel.
Table 1-2 gives I
panel
values for solar panels recommended by Fisher Controls.
Table 1-2. Solar Panel Sizing
Panel I
panel
4.5 watt 0.27 amps
5 watt 0.29 amps
10 watt 0.58 amps
